MALONE, WALLEN NEED NO "HELP" ACHIEVING MILESTONE

Post Malone's country era is off to the races—with "I Had Some Help," the Mercury/Republic hitmaker, alongside Morgan Wallen, generated the most streams ever in a single day for a country song on Spotify.

The collab opened at #1 on the platform 5/10 with 14m global streams. The feat also affords Wallen the first global #1 of his career. The track likewise debuted at #1 stateside, posting 7.8m streams.

Just last month Malone was part of an even bigger milestone care of Taylor Swift's "Fortnight," which logged the most daily streams ever for a song—25.2m—and was the biggest-ever all-genre debut.
